Graph: Types of graphs

SEISMIC-RNA can create eight types of graphs:

Graph

Description

profile

Bar graph of relationships(s) (e.g. mutation rate or read coverage) per position

delprof

Bar graph of differences between two profiles per position

scatter

Scatter plot comparing two profiles

corroll

Rolling correlation/comparison of two profiles

histpos

Histogram of relationship(s) per position

histread

Histogram of relationship(s) per read

roc

Receiver operating characteristic (ROC) curve comparing a profile to a structure

aucroll

Rolling area under the ROC curve (AUC-ROC) comparing a profile to a structure

Graph: Default graphs

You can make six graphs when you run the entire workflow (seismic wf):

  • Profile of the fraction of reads mutated (the mutation rate) at each position.

  • Profile of the fraction of each type of mutation at each position.

  • Profile of the number of reads with information at each position.

  • Histogram of the number of positions mutated in each read.

  • ROC for each predicted structure (with --fold).

  • Rolling AUC-ROC for each predicted structure (with --fold).

These graphs are created by default in seismic wf. To make additional types of graphs, see Graph Results.
